Responsibilities:

The PMO Manager will oversee two areas within the Implementation and Strategic Initiatives department:

  • Project Managers
    • CMS Certification Leads

They will oversee at least 6 direct reports and will report directly to the Senior Director of Implementation and Strategic Initiatives. The resources they will oversee will be part of a cross-functional team and may have responsibilities for resources on the client side or vendors. The PMO Manager will support the Change Healthcare Pharmacy Benefit Services (PBS) team in the following areas:

  • Responsible for PMO team adhering to the following key performance indicators:
    • Best Practices
    • Financial Stewardship
    • Inspire Resources
    • Maximize team member impact and increase accountability
    • Process Innovation
    • Professional Development
  • Manages resources who are responsible for business projects and programs involving cross functional teams and delivering products through the design process to completion.
  • Provides day-to-day technical management as required of departmental staff.
  • Responsible for the definition and maintenance of the standards of project management and process.
  • Accountable for team leadership and development.
  • Manages key vendor relationships.
  • Maintains a general bias to action by being ready to roll up their sleeves and get into the details, not being afraid to wear multiple hats.
  • Acts as a trusted partner to key constituencies by learning their business to anticipate stakeholder needs and concerns.
  • Responsible for the establishment and management of a project methodology incorporating structures, standards, processes, documentation and reporting which is agile, fits the needs of the project and puts emphasis on the quality of decision making and timely project delivery.
  • Clarifying the deliverables of internal and external PMO stakeholders and contribute to success through cooperative and collegial processes.
  • Contributes to the formulation of approved business plans, operating plans, budgets and capital expenditure requests in line with CHC strategic goals and objectives.
  • Maintains processes to ensure project management documentation, reports and plans are relevant, accurate and complete.
  • Assists and advises Project Sponsors, Functional Managers, and teams to the best use of project management disciplines and approaches within a fast-paced, high tech environment.
  • Develops positive relationships with Project Sponsors, Functional Managers, and teams to enable the PMO to provide support including facilitation, tracking and reporting on projects, and training.
  • Supports and verifies Project Manager's managing resource allocation, including adjustments based on emerging business or technical opportunities and challenges.
  • Acts as a reference point for PMO queries and information and an advocate for best practices in project management.
  • Shares lessons learned and best practices across programs, building relationships with stakeholders and brokering relationships at all levels.
  • Analyzes challenges the project team is facing, generating quick and viable solutions.
  • Ensures client satisfaction, quality of work, and project profitability.
  • Plans, tracks, and approves project expenses, billing, and invoices. Maintain budget of planned vs. actual.
  • Possesses excellent communication (verbal/written) skills - able to tailor communications to different audiences - execs, business sponsors, developers, customers, partners, etc.
  • Adapts project approach based on project conditions and circumstances.
  • Contributes to PMO by building processes and protocols for the team's benefit with team input.
  • Builds relationships with existing clients, participates in RFP process, leads client presentations with appropriate team members and directors, and looks for opportunities to further increase client engagement through additional CHC disciplines.
  • Identifies and resolves root cause issues, finding positive solutions to problems.
  • Supports Project Manager's leading multi-disciplinary technology teams in the achievement of technical project objectives and assists in removing barriers.
  • Facilitates team information and workflow.
  • Removes barriers to timely and cost effective project completion.
  • Shares budget, schedule, milestone, and cost/benefit decision-making responsibilities with technology executives and managers.
  • Presents issues to and negotiates with top management to resolve resource conflicts.
  • Serves as a resource to project managers, assisting them in the resolution of complex problems or leading them on larger projects.
  • Supports the budgeting process by developing and monitoring budgets for teams.
  • Coordinates and tracks technology project resources, staff, assets, and schedules to ensure timely project outcomes.
  • Serves as escalation point for all project related issues.
  • Travel may be required.

Minimum Requirements:

5+ years of technical project experience in the healthcare industry, specifically in Medicaid and/or Medicare required.

Education:

Bachelor's degree required.

PMP Certification required.

Critical Skills:

People management experience is required.as is experience managing multi-disciplinary teams

Proficiency building project plans, including dependencies and predecessors, with MS Project required.

Proficiency with MS Office Suite, including MS Project required.

Proven track record of effective technical project management that keeps technical projects true to specification required.

Deep understanding and experience leading projects using SDLC, Agile and Lean methodologies required.

Management of large-scale healthcare projects with teams of 10 or more and budgets greater than $1 million required.

Demonstrated positive outcomes developing and implementing approaches to achieve compliance with federal regulatory requirements required.

Strong analytical and time management skills required.

Strong interpersonal, verbal, and written communication skills required.

Preferred Skills:

Advanced Degree in related field preferred.

CSM certification preferred.
